The Top Ten Reasons to get an MBA at Nevada
- Quality: The MBA program at the University of Nevada, Reno is ranked as the 21st best part-time MBA program in the United States in 2009 according to BusinessWeek.
- Price: The total cost for a Nevada resident for a Nevada MBA is slightly over $14,000.
- Value: Considering both the quality and the price, the Nevada MBA may be the best educational value in the nation.
- Flexible Scheduling: The Nevada MBA program accommodates the needs of full and part time students by offering all evening courses. Students can complete a degree at their own pace without interrupting their professional career.
- Faculty: Internationally respected scholars with real world experiences who have a passion to teach and inspire their students.
- Class Size: With an average class size of 32, students don’t get lost in the crowd.
- Curriculum: A relevant and cutting edge curriculum that students gave a grade of “B” in the Business Week Survey.
- Career Connections: With extensive ties to local, regional, and national business communities the Office of Career Connections helps students and alumni successfully plan and advance their careers.
- Accreditation: Our MBA program is among a select group of worldwide graduate business programs accredited by the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B), the highest level of accreditation attainable in business education.
- Areas of Emphasis: The Nevada MBA program offers areas of emphasis in accounting, finance, gaming management, information technology, and supply chain management.
